Slopestyle Practice



First day of Slopestyle practice in Rotorua with primo dirt and all the riders having a blast riding the course weaving through the redwoods, designed and built by Tom Hey and Kelly McGarry (Elevate Build and Design). Being the first big contest of the year, all the riders are feeling out their bikes and keeping things pretty mellow for the first day.
